Fig. 2. Abnormalities in the adult brain of En1cre/+;
Otx2flox/flox mutants. (A-D) Midbrain and cerebellum of
adult En1cre/+ and En1cre/+;
Otx2flox/flox mice are compared in dorsal view (A), or in
sagittal (B,C) and frontal (D) Nissl-stained sections. (E) High magnification
of the area demarcated by a square in (D). (F) Th immunostaining of the DA
area in a frontal section close to (D). The arrows in B indicate the
approximate position of frontal sections. InC, inferior colliculus; SuC,
superior colliculus; OM oculomotor nucleus; RN, red nucleus; SN, substantia
nigra; VTA, ventral tegmental area.
